Where notice of hearing is required to be posted as provided in this section:
(a) At least 15 days before the time set for the hearing, the court clerk shall cause a notice of the time and place of the hearing to be posted at the courthouse of the county where the proceedings are pending. If court is held at a place other than the county seat, the notice may be posted either at the courthouse of the county where the proceedings are pending or at the building where the court is held.
(b) The posted notice of hearing shall state all of the following:
(1) The name of the estate.
(2) The name of the petitioner.
(3) The nature of the petition, referring to the petition for further particulars.
(4) The time and place of the hearing of the petition.
